About Isabelle
I'm a recent college graduate from the University of Chicago, and a lover of French language and literature throughout the Francophone world. I've been studying French for ten years. From my academic studies and my time spent living with French-speaking families, I command both formal aspects of French language expression, such as grammar, orthography, and vocabulary, in addition to informal aspects of French conversation, like vernacular vocabulary and oral comprehension. Over the course of high school and college, I have lived in French-speaking countries on three occasions: I spent a year living with a host family in Rennes, France; a summer on an intensive language study grant in Paris with my university; and a winter living with a French-speaking family in Rabat, Morocco. At UChicago, I also minored in French, diving into French literature from the 17th century to today. Next year, I'll be moving back to France--Marseille specifically-- to teach on a Fulbright, but for now, I'm excited to share my love of French with students at home.

I am an energetic, laid-back, and compassionate mentor. After a decade learning French in a variety of locations, from discussion-based classrooms and group study sessions to dinner table conversations and trips to the Saturday market with my host mother, I've developed a teaching style that is very casual, conversational, and collaborative. I like to hear from my students what interests them, and use those interests to drive language learning activities. Moreover, as a former engagement intern for my campus Hillel and the president of a campus residential community, I’ve had the privilege to work with students from diverse backgrounds, from members of a pluralistic Jewish community to students from across the world in our dorm, and our conversations have taught me the importance of listening first to understand a student's individual story and needs. As I continue to learn myself, I know how to exercise patience and constantly encourage my students.
